SPECIAL RETIREMENT AGREEMENT
THIS SPECIAL RETIREMENT AGREEMENT (“Agreement”) is effective as of the 12th of August, 2008 (the “Effective Date”), by and between American Family Life Assurance Company of Columbus (“Aflac”) and Akitoshi Kan (“Kan”).
STATEMENT OF BACKGROUND
WHEREAS, Kan and Aflac enjoyed a mutually beneficial employment relationship during which time Kan provided invaluable leadership as a senior executive officer; and
WHEREAS, Kan retired from employment and separated from service with Aflac effective as of June 30, 2008 (the “Retirement Date”); and
WHEREAS, in recognition of his years of dedicated service, Aflac desires to provide certain additional retirement benefits to Kan;
NOW THEREFORE, in consideration of the mutual promises contained in this Agreement and other good and valuable consideration, the sufficiency of which hereby is acknowledged, Aflac and Kan agree as follows:
STATEMENT OF AGREEMENT
1. Special Retirement Benefits. In recognition of Kan’s dedication and service to Aflac, subject to the terms of this Agreement, Aflac will pay Kan the special retirement benefits described below in this Section.
(a) Lump-Sum Benefit. Kan shall receive a single, lump-sum distribution in the amount of TWO HUNDRED EIGHTY-SIX THOUSAND FIVE HUNDRED DOLLARS AND NO CENTS ($286,500.00). The lump-sum payment to Kan under this Section 1(a) will be paid on or before September 1, 2008. The lump-sum payment under this provision will be subject to all applicable taxes and other withholdings.
(b) Recurring Benefit. Commencing as of January 1, 2009, Aflac shall pay to Kan as a special retirement benefit, a monthly amount equal to THREE THOUSAND FOUR HUNDRED FIFTY-NINE DOLLARS AND SIXTY-FIVE CENTS ($3,459.65) less applicable taxes and other withholdings. The payments under this provision shall continue for each calendar month through the calendar month in which Kan’s death occurs, at which time Aflac’s obligation under this Section 1(b) shall automatically cease; provided, however, that should Kan predecease his spouse, Aflac shall continue (commencing for the calendar month following the calendar month in which Kan dies) to make monthly payments to her in

the amount of ONE THOUSAND SEVEN HUNDRED TWENTY-NINE DOLLARS AND EIGHTY-THREE CENTS ($1,729.83) through the calendar month in which her death occurs. Upon receipt of notice of Kan’s death (or his spouse’s death as may be applicable), Aflac shall make any final payment due under this provision to the appropriate legal estate.
2. Benefits Not Assignable. The special retirement benefits set forth in Section 1 of this Agreement are intended solely for the benefit of Kan (and his spouse) and are not assignable without the prior written approval of Aflac, nor shall the same be transferred by operation of law without Aflac’s written consent. Any such attempted or purported assignment without such prior written consent shall be voidable at Aflac’s option.
3. No Effect on Other Benefits. The amount and payment of the benefits hereunder shall have no effect on the amount or payment of any other benefits or other amounts due to Kan from Aflac.
4. I.R.C. Section 409A. This Agreement documents a legally binding right created on August 12, 2008, by action of the Compensation Committee of the Aflac Board of Directors, and is drafted so as to comply with Section 409A of the Internal Revenue Code of 1986, as amended (“Section 409A”). Each and every payment made pursuant to this Agreement shall be considered a separate payment for purposes of Section 409A. To the extent that any provision of this Agreement or any amount payable to Kan by Aflac or any Aflac plan is deemed to violate Section 409A, the parties will negotiate in good faith an alternative arrangement that will comply with the requirements of Section 409A.
